A play is written before the audience’s eyes in the Racine Theatre Guild’s upcoming production of “That Darn Plot” from Friday, February 24 through Sunday, March 12.
Mark W. Transom is one of the world’s greatest playwrights and has been tasked with writing a new play in one night. As he sits at his typewriter, the plot takes shape until Mark’s estranged son appears as a character and the play veers out of control. The line between the story being written and Mark’s life becomes blurred, forcing him face his own reality. Humorous and heartfelt, this comedy puts a new spin on a play within a play.
